Job Title: Dental Office Manager
About Us:
We're a family-owned practice focused on general dentistry and committed to providing exceptional care. Our mission is to help our patient retain their teeth for life whenever possible. We follow a set of core values that emphasize teamwork, integrity, and delivering the highest quality dental care.
Position Overview:
We are seeking a highly organized and motivated Dental Office Manager to oversee the daily operations of our dental practice. The ideal candidate will play a crucial role in ensuring a smooth, efficient, and patient-focused office environment. This position requires strong leadership skills, exceptional communication abilities, and a thorough understanding of dental office procedures and regulations.
Key Responsibilities:
- Manage day-to-day operations of the dental office, including front desk activities, patient scheduling, billing, and insurance verification.
- Supervise and train administrative staff, dental assistants, and dental hygienists to ensure the highest level of patient care.
- Develop and implement office policies and procedures to improve efficiency and enhance patient experience.
- Oversee financial operations including budgeting, accounting, and inventory management.
- Ensure compliance with all dental and healthcare regulations and maintain patient confidentiality.
- Maintain positive patient relationships and address any concerns or complaints in a professional manner.
- Monitor and improve office productivity and workflow, identifying areas for improvement.
- Coordinate with dental providers to ensure effective communication and collaboration within the team.
- Maintain a welcoming environment for patients and visitors, ensuring cleanliness and organization of the office.
- Handle marketing efforts and community outreach to promote the dental practice and attract new patients.
Qualifications:
- High school diploma or equivalent;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ree in healthcare administration, business management, or a related field preferred.
- Previous experience in a dental office or healthcare management role is required (3-5 years preferred).
- Strong understanding of dental terminology, procedures, and office protocols.
- Proficient in dental practice management software (e.g., Dentrix Ascend ) and Microsoft Office Suite.
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, both verbal and written.
- Proven leadership and team management abilities.
-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
- Ability to multitask and thrive in a fast-paced environment.
